Relief Able-Bodied Seaman – Maine State Ferry Service

Join the Maine State Ferry Service and play a vital role in connecting Maine’s beautiful island communities, including Vinalhaven, North Haven, Swans Island, and Islesboro. Based out of Rockland, this relief position offers a unique lifestyle opportunity with state-provided island housing, free parking, and a non-taxable meal per-diem. You will be part of a dedicated crew ensuring the safe transportation of passengers and cargo across coastal routes. The role comes with an exceptional public-sector benefits package, including 13 paid holidays, 100% employer-paid dental premiums, and a significant 13.29% retirement contribution.


Responsibilities

  • Handles mooring lines during docking/undocking operations

  • Verifies and collects boarding tickets

  • Assists in the loading/unloading of passengers and vehicles

  • Cleans/paints interior and exterior vessel structure, gear, and equipment

  • Participates in safety drills and operations

  • Stands helm and lookout watches in wheelhouse

  • Performs security duties IAW the Vessel Security Plan

Requirements

  • Valid U.S. Coast Guard Merchant Mariners Document (MMD) with AB endorsement

  • Current TWIC (Transportation Workers Identification Credential)

  • Experience as a deck crew member of vessels operating on ocean or coastal routes

  • U.S. Coast Guard certificate as able seaman and lifeboatman

  • Physically capable of performing all duties of Ferry Able Seaman


About the Role

As a relief Able-Bodied Seaman, you will maintain the operational integrity and safety of our ferry vessels. Your daily routine involves high-activity tasks such as handling mooring lines, managing vehicle loading/unloading (including transfer bridge operation), and performing essential vessel maintenance through cleaning and painting. You will also serve as a critical component of the bridge team, standing helm and lookout watches, and ensuring compliance with the Vessel Security Plan. This role requires staying on the assigned island during your duty rotation, utilizing well-equipped state housing while working in a dynamic maritime environment.
